AVAudioSession.DeactivationResult
Type-safe representation of audio session deactivation results.
Declaration
enum DeactivationResultOverview
This enum provides a Swift-idiomatic way to handle deactivation scenarios with associated values, ensuring impossible states are prevented at compile time.
Topics
Getting the deactivation result
See Also
Observing activation lifecycle
didBecomeActiveNotificationdidBecomeInactiveNotificationresumptionRecommendationNotificationdeactivationContextKeyresumptionContextKeyAVAudioSession.DidBecomeActiveMessageAVAudioSession.DidBecomeInactiveMessageAVAudioSession.ResumptionRecommendationMessageAVAudioSession.DeactivationContextAVAudioSession.DeactivationSourceAVAudioSession.InterruptionContextAVAudioSession.ResumptionContextAVAudioSession.ResumptionRecommendation